Liberty Energy (LBRT)

UBS analyst Josh Silverstein reiterated a Buy rating on Liberty Energy today and set a price target of $40.00. The company’s shares closed last Thursday at $27.25.

According to TipRanks.com, Silverstein is a 5-star analyst with an average return of 9.6% and a 58.5% success rate. Silverstein covers the NA sector, focusing on stocks such as National Energy Services Reunited, ARKO Petroleum Corp. Class A, and Weatherford International. ;'>

Currently, the analyst consensus on Liberty Energy is a Moderate Buy with an average price target of $33.00.

Precision Drilling (PDS)

In a report released yesterday, Keith Mackey from RBC Capital maintained a Buy rating on Precision Drilling, with a price target of C$150.00. The company’s shares closed last Thursday at $79.16.

According to TipRanks.com, Mackey is a 5-star analyst with an average return of 25.3% and a 64.0% success rate. Mackey covers the NA sector, focusing on stocks such as Weatherford International, Atlas Energy Solutions, and CES Energy Solutions. ;'>

The word on The Street in general, suggests a Strong Buy analyst consensus rating for Precision Drilling with a $107.06 average price target.
